]> git.saurik.com Git - wxWidgets.git/blobdiff - src/mac/control.cpp
don't include windows.h unless neccessary
[wxWidgets.git] / src / mac / control.cpp
index 29698c6839d25af6d99146af818bb54f2af89bec..f3973a3190f230f4cd51ab26b9731f9f37f1a6a7 100644 (file)
@@ -103,11 +103,11 @@ wxControl::~wxControl()
     m_isBeingDeleted = TRUE;
     // If we delete an item, we should initialize the parent panel,
     // because it could now be invalid.
-    wxPanel *panel = wxDynamicCast(GetParent(), wxPanel);
-    if ( panel )
+    wxWindow *parent = GetParent() ;
+    if ( parent )
     {
-        if (panel->GetDefaultItem() == (wxButton*) this)
-            panel->SetDefaultItem(NULL);
+        if (parent->GetDefaultItem() == (wxButton*) this)
+            parent->SetDefaultItem(NULL);
     }
     if ( m_macControl )
     {